Re: NITK Entrance Exam
Joint Entrance Examination (JEE) Mains is an all India common entrance examination which is conducted for admission in various engineering courses like B. Tech, B.E, B. Arch and B. Planning in various NITs. NIT B. Tech Admissions at NIT, Karnataka 2016-2017 Eligibility NIT offers B. Tech courses in Chemical Engineering, Metallurgical & Materials Engineering, Civil Engineering, Civil Engineering, Computer Engineering, Electrical and Electronics Engineering, Metallurgical & Materials Engineering, Electronics & Communication Engineering, Information Technology, Mechanical Engineering and Mining Engineering. The admission to the B. Tech Courses are on the basis of entrance exam scores they attained from JEE Main entrance exam conducted by the C.B.S.C board New Delhi. One must have obtained at least 60% in their intermediate test. Half of the seats are reserved for the candidates belonging from Karnataka and rest of the half seats are reserved for the candidates belonging from other regions of India. 10 % of total seats in the Undergraduate Graduate courses are reserved for the foreign candidates under the Direct Admission of Student Abroad (DASA) Scheme. DASA is an independent organization working under the Ministry of HRD Government of India. Admission of the foreign students is determined from the scores earned in Mathematics, Physics, and chemistry.
